On a side note, this is not new. The rules and regs from 2006 state that "management feels that abnormally dyed hair(such as pink, blue, orange, and other colors not found in nature) is unacceptable in the marketplace" and that "head coverings (hats, etc) will be MANDATORY during Festival hours and all facial piercings must be removed during Festival days. As well, tattoos must be covered." on page 3; also "No visual body piercing will be allowed except 1 pair of pierced earrings. All tatoos [sic] must be covered." and "No un-ordinary haircuts or hair colors are acceptable" on page 5. 

So, it may be newly enforced, but this is not a new concept.
